Eastern Cape ANC shocked by murder of councillor Thumeka Bikwana

The African National Congress in the Eastern Cape has expressed shock at the killing of Thumeka Bikwana, a member of the Mayoral Committee for Corporate Services in the Chris Hani District. Her body was found with a bullet wound at her home in Tshatshu Village on Tuesday.

The party described Bikwana as a dedicated public servant and loyal politician. Provincial spokesperson Yanga Zicina urged law enforcement agencies to act swiftly in bringing those responsible to justice.

Zicina highlighted the ongoing problem of gender-based violence in the province. He noted that the murder of women activists and public servants remains a serious concern for communities across the Eastern Cape.

The ANC called for a thorough investigation into the circumstances of the death. Officials have not released further details about suspects or possible motives at this stage.

ActionSA suspends Tshwane MMC Kholofelo Morodi

Сообщено ИИ Изображение, созданное ИИ

ActionSA has suspended City of Tshwane councillor and Corporate and Shared Services MMC Kholofelo Morodi as a party member pending a preliminary investigation into Madlanga Commission allegations. Tshwane Mayor Nasiphi Moya earlier placed her on special leave after evidence allegedly showed her sharing internal land lease tender documents with police sergeant Fannie Nkosi. The moves aim to uphold transparency and accountability.

Police in South Africa's North West province have arrested a suspect in the stabbing death of Matlosana Municipality councillor Sello Molefi outside a tavern in Klerksdorp. The 46-year-old was killed during an argument over a girlfriend, according to investigators. The 35-year-old suspect is set to appear in court on a murder charge.

Human rights defender Zweli “Khabazela” Mkhize was shot and killed on the evening of 12 February 2026 in the eNkanini commune, Allendale, Gauteng. He served as treasurer of the local Abahlali baseMjondolo branch despite ongoing threats. The incident draws attention ahead of Human Rights Day on 21 March.

Two educators were shot in Gauteng's East Rand on 13 April 2026, one fatally, highlighting a pattern of violence against school principals and senior staff. The South African Democratic Teachers’ Union has described the attacks as targeted, linked to governance and finances. School leaders report living in constant fear amid inadequate security.

The late Bishop John Bolana, the fifth bishop of the Bantu Church of Christ, will be laid to rest on Sunday in Gqeberha. Eastern Cape Premier Oscar Mabuyane is set to deliver the eulogy at the funeral service. The event has been classified as a special provincial official category 2 funeral in recognition of Bolana's contributions.
